Transaction 0077e526db39c2cda78cac523cbbab77c91d6611abeab76826d236a360253094

1 Input
2 Outputs
  • 0077e526db39c2cda78cac523cbbab77c91d6611abeab76826d236a360253094:0
  • value  3785666
    address  1MSL1yfL1T1mM6EFVifVaFD3n1UHMuompq
  • 0077e526db39c2cda78cac523cbbab77c91d6611abeab76826d236a360253094:1
  • value  13000000
    address  3FwDFTVz7APXrh4MsaHWep5uwzs1KFvN29